Salium is the Telian name for an element that is present in all parts of the galaxy and theorized by Telian scientists to be the second most abundant element around. It is the result of the fusion of two Telium atoms, present in most studied stellar bodies. It is the simplest atomic pairing that can be achieved and is the by-product of Telium fusion reaction (as well as abundant energy). Telian scientists have determined that Shiss, the primary stellar body of the Shiss System, is currently made up of around 73% telium and 27% salium.
Salium is also present in the atmosphere of Telios Prime, although in small percentages only. Used extensively in several industrial settings, salium is often stored in liquid state, under pressure in specialized containers and is much more stable than telium in those conditions.
